A Toyota keyless entry system is a remote control unit that allows the driver to lock and unlock the vehicle doors without using a metal key. This entry system offers convenience to the driver. The keyless entry system has become standard in most new Toyota models. There are two types of keyless entry systems; the remote keyless entry system and the smart key keyless entry system.
Remote Keyless Entry System
This entry system uses a remote control unit, commonly known as a key fob. It allows the driver to control the car doors from a distance. With a key fob, the driver can lock or unlock the car doors and, in some cases, start the engine. The key fob sends out low-frequency radio signals that communicate with the car's computer. To unlock the doors, the driver has to press the button on the key fob. They can also lock the doors with a single press of the key fob button. The remote keyless entry system improves vehicle security since unauthorized users cannot access the car without the key fob. The key fob also has a physical key inside, which the driver can use to unlock the doors manually in case of a dead battery.
Smart Key Keyless Entry System
The smart key keyless entry system is a more advanced version of the remote keyless entry system. With this system, the driver doesn't have to touch the key fob to unlock the doors. There are sensors around the vehicle that detect the key fob when it comes close. The system will automatically unlock the doors when it senses the key fob within a particular distance. The system allows the driver to access the car and unlock the doors without using their hands. Also, the driver can start the engine without going through the ignition system. The smart key keyless entry system boosts convenience, especially for busy people.
The specifications of Toyota keyless entry systems vary depending on the model and year of the car. All systems, however, consist of a remote key fob and a control unit.
The key fob has a battery, a transmitter, and a receiver. The transmitter sends out low-frequency radio signals to the control unit when the user presses a button. The receiver gets the signals and processes them, performing the necessary action, such as locking or unlocking the doors. The control unit also communicates with the key fob and executes the command.
Some common specifications of the Toyota keyless entry system are as follows.
Frequency
The key fob communicates with the control unit through a low-frequency radio signal. Different models operate on different frequencies, such as 315 MHz or 433 MHz. The operating frequency affects the range and interference susceptibility.
Batteries
The key fob contains batteries that can last for several years with proper care. Users should replace the batteries periodically to ensure the key fob works properly. Depending on the model, the key fob may use CR2016, CR2025, or CR2032 batteries.
Security
Some keyless entry systems have rolling code technology to improve security. This feature prevents code grabbing attacks. In rolling code systems, the key fob and control unit generate a new code for each transmission based on a secret key and a random number.
Integration
The keyless entry system may integrate with other vehicle security features, such as an alarm system or immobilizer. Some high-end models also integrate with GPS tracking systems. Integrated systems provide better security by making unauthorized access very difficult.
Maintaining the Toyota keyless entry system is important to ensure it works properly. Here are some maintenance tips.
Clean the key fob
Over time, dirt, dust, and debris can accumulate on the key fob, clogging the buttons and the transmitter. This can affect the signal strength and the functionality of the key fob. Users should clean the key fob regularly, at least once a month. A soft cloth, mild soap, and water are enough to do the cleaning.
Replace the battery
The battery will eventually lose its charge, and users may notice a weaker signal or reduced range. Depending on the usage, users should replace the battery every one to three years. They should also strive to use the recommended battery type.
Avoid physical damage
The key fob can suffer physical damage if it drops or if it comes into contact with liquids. Users should protect the key fob from such hazards. Using a key fob case can help protect it from physical damage.
Avoid interference
Different electronic devices, such as microwaves, Bluetooth devices, and cordless phones, can interfere with the key fob's signal. Users should keep these devices away from the key fob to prevent signal interference.

Key fob batteries are designed to last for years, but they will eventually run out. Fortunately, replacing the battery in a key fob is a simple DIY project. All that's needed is a small screwdriver and a replacement battery. The first step is to find the right replacement battery for the key fob.
The Toyota keyless entry system uses a lithium battery. However, the specifications may vary depending on the key fob model. For example, some key fobs use a CR1632 battery, while others use a CR2032 battery. It's essential to check the owner's manual or consult a Toyota dealer to confirm the correct battery type. Once the battery has been procured, open the key fob by removing the screws or prying it apart with a small flathead screwdriver. Be careful not to damage the plastic casing.
Take note of the battery's orientation before removing it from the key fob. This information will help ensure the new battery is installed in the correct direction. Install the new battery in the key fob, making sure it's seated properly. Then, close the key fob case and tighten the screws or snap it shut. If the key fob is glued shut, a small amount of super glue will suffice.
If the key fob is still not working after a battery replacement, it may need reprogramming. In most cases, a Toyota vehicle allows up to five key fobs. Therefore, if a new key fob is replaced, the old one may still be programmed into the system. Reprogramming a key fob can be a bit more challenging than a simple battery replacement. Fortunately, there are various online resources with instructions for reprogramming key fobs for specific Toyota models. Alternatively, consult a certified Toyota locksmith or dealer for assistance.
To prevent further issues with the key fob, avoid dropping it and keep it away from moisture. If the key fob case is cracked, replace it to avoid damage to the internal components. When using a new key fob, ensure it is properly programmed to match the vehicle's security system.
Q1. Can a keyless entry system be installed on any car?
A1. In most cases, a keyless entry system can be installed in any car. However, it is more straightforward to install it in cars that do not already have one.
Q2. What is the difference between keyless entry and keyless ignition?
A2. Keyless entry allows the driver to unlock and lock the car doors without physically using the key. Keyless ignition allows the driver to start and stop the engine without using a key physically.
Q3. How does a keyless entry system know its remote?
A3. Keyless entry systems use a unique code that both the remote and the car system share. When the user presses a button on the remote, it sends the code to the car. If the car recognizes the code, it knows the remote and unlocks the doors.
Q4. What do users do when the keyless entry remote stops working?
A4. First, they should check the battery and replace it if necessary. If the problem persists, they should look for physical damages or contact the dealer for repairs.
